Date/Time: Saturday, 6 December 2003 9:30-12:00am
Location: PCH
Weather: Sunny, slight breeze
Conditions: From clean and pitching out to mushy and rumbling
Swell: 10.6' @ 17s @ 295°
Tide: 3.0 and dropping
Surf: Shoulder High with some Overhead Rogues
Board: Walden
Wetsuit Sessions: 034 ($7.35/session)

Comments:

This was the most hyped up swell of the winter. It had been over a month since we'd had a good NW'er due to a high pressure system off of Alaska, so surfers were hungry. Wetsand was doing the typical pumping up, calling for DOH conditions at standout spots, Surf Countries Doug was pumping it up on KJEE, and people were poring out of the woodwork waiting for this one.

We formed a possee of Rio and Greggory leaving SB and heading south to meet Unkle. We opted to go out later and face crowds and perhaps a lower tide. We met along the PCH, it looked good and we paddled out to a slow point. The four of us hung out here for awhile and then we rallied to paddle up to Three Trees. Somehow it was only Unkle and I, Rio and Greggory were having fun at our intial spot.

Three Trees was much faster and with better shape, but with the crowds to prove it. People everywhere but somehow the spot was supporting them all. Unkle and I hung in on the very far fringes, catching the ones that sectioned out. These were really long rides with really long paddle backs. We were mostly keeping to the chest High or so ones and a lot of waist high ones, perfect shape, peeling and peeling. Sometimes a bomb would come in and I only caught one or two waves that were head high. These sectioned out a lot quicker and none of these provided quite the long ride. Unkle was just getting over a cold so he was slow and tired but did manage to pull into a couple of fun ones. I was getting tired, the bowl of cereal was not providing enough energy.

The tide was dropping rapidly and our little peak soon merged with the one up further meaning we were no longer getting waves all to ourselves but were having to back out as guys made it past the section that until then was our friend. I tried paddling into the pack and wrestling one down but it was packed. Saw Levin and chatted it up with him after he caught a screamer from way up top. Not bad for an old man shortboarding.

Soon Unkle and I were pooped and headed down to find the boys. Ran into Greggory and he convinced us to paddle out once more and catch a long one in. The paddle out was painful on the arms but catching one more wave in was a good time. Unkle caught long one and did his unknowingly Da Bull pose all the way to the sand.
